In view of the planned development of large unitized container ships that will serve only a few major 'express' ports, there is growing interest in the possibility of instituting waterborne feeder services (WFS) to and from subsidiary ports. A study was made to examine the desirability and feasibility of such services. Volume I is devoted to assessing the demand for WFS in sample trade environments, and to selecting vehicle specifications appropriate to these environments. (Author)
Waterborne Feeder Subsystems for Unitized Cargo Transportation, Volume I
